What is an eSIM?

An eSIM, is just another sim card, and already built into your phone. That means youcan’t remove or replace it, only activate it. So we activate it by connecting it tocellular provider, like normal, Vodaphone, T-Mobile, Globe, or Airtel for example.However, the big difference is that you can have several plans in your phone at thesame time. So you can have Vodaphone, T-Mobile, and Airtel and switch betweenthem when you want to.

Do I have to change my old number?

No, you keep your previous number, and use it just like you do now. Your eSIM allowsyou to add several new plans to use as well
